[Flashback]

“I’m afraid to say this but your son is blind.” The world came crushing down for the woman in her late twenties. She inhaled deeply and pick up her son from the basket. She then stood up and walk slowly towards the exit, but before she left she gave the man a warning, “If words of my son’s incapability to see them reach my husband’s ears I will not hesitate to kill you and your family.”

                Giving birth to another blind heir would no doubt anger the main house; they will not hesitate to kill off the baby that was just born. She knew in herself that she has to run away and hide her son. It will be considered betrayal against the main house and she has no doubt that if she were ever caught, even greater tragedies will await her children.

After the dinner, Hanae’s mother instructed her son to wash the dishes and prepare the bath. “I wanted to have a little chat with Abeno-san about you Hanae. It’s better if you don’t listen you wouldn’t want me to spill all the embarrassing things you did when you were a child right?” she teased her son.

Hanae’s face turned red as he gave up in joining my conversation with his mother. Ashiya’s mother invited me to join her to watch the television in the living room while Ashiya was left in the kitchen to wash the dishes. From my past experience and conversation with Hanae, it would seem that he is oblivious to the fact that his mother is related to the arts of exorcism. I could imagine as to why she kept it a secret, from Hanae’s stories he was only able to see yokais and akasyashi when he was possessed by the hair ball, he would have found it unbelievable if his mother told him about her secret occupation.

Once we were seated, his mother offered me snacks from the basket lying on the living room table. When I refused what she offered, she let out a sighed and went to talk about her past action.  “I would like to apologize, Abeno-san. I was suspicious of you. After hearing stories from Hanae about you, I immediately knew that you were an exorcist. I was afraid that you were one of them.” Her words were not making sense. I could not decipher what she meant by “one of them” was Ashiya’s family running away from an enemy? Though I am aware that there are established families in Japan that deals with exorcism in a different manner, it never occurred to me that Ashiya’s family may be involved in one of them.

It was very rare for humans to have the ability to be able to see yokais, only about 1 of ten thousand people has the spiritual ability to see them, and an even smaller percentage of them could use the spiritual arts to seal or permanently destroy their existence. Established families in the field of exorcism used to be famous around Japan, but as they gradually lost heirs who could see the supernatural, the families also stopped practicing the field. To my knowledge, only one family is still in the practice of exorcism, the Asakura Family.  

She must have seen my confused look, as she rubbed her forehead and continue what she was saying, “Ashiya is a well established family in the field of exorcisms. They were seen as the heroes of Edo after Abe no Seime’s death. Lately, the family has been running out of heirs that would continue the family business. I am the wife of one of the sons of the main family. It is my duty to give birth to children who would learn the technique and pass it down to their children.”

“But neither of your children could see yokais when they were born, am I correct?”

“Yes, when my daughter and Hanae were born, both of them could not see the servants who were attending to them. The main house has no room for children who would not have any use in the family, they would not think twice in killing them. Now that Hanae could see them, I am afraid that they would come and take him away.”

Disgusting. There was no other word for it. The family only thought of their children as nothing but puppets that would do their bidding and if they are no longer in need or they have no use for them they would not hesitate to toss them aside and dispose of them. Humans have never failed to continuously disappoint me. I looked at the figure in front of me. Ashiya’s mother must be in her early 40’s. She was still young, but years of living in fear must have taken a toll on her. I imagine her sitting behind the counter of the flower shop, worrying whether her son would be back home safely. I wanted to offer her kind words but I doubt saying anything would lift the burden that she was carrying.

 “I would like to thank you for everything you have ever done Abeno-san, I was happy seeing Hanae toge- “  when she was about to finish her sentence a sudden bright light engulfed the house. Unable to do anything, I used my hands to cover my eyes.  But once the light was gone, a screamed echoed throughout the house.

It was Hanae’s voice.

The moment the light faded from the room, I immediately blink twice until I could have a source of awareness to my surroundings. I ran towards the kitchen to look for Hanae, but only the unwashed dishes were left on the sink. Trying to be optimistic about the situation, I tried looking for the bathroom to see if he was there preparing the bath, but the moment I saw that the lights was closed, I already gave up, I have to admit to myself that..

                Hanae was gone.
